downloads | documentation | faq | getting help | mailing lists | licenses | wiki | reporting bugs | php.net sites | conferences | my php.net

search for in the

SplFileObject::flock> <SplFileObject::fgets
[edit] Last updated: Fri, 07 Jun 2013

view this page in

SplFileObject::fgetss

(PHP 5 >= 5.1.0)

SplFileObject::fgetssObtiene la línea de el fichero y elimina etiquetas HTML

Descripción

public string SplFileObject::fgetss ([ string $allowable_tags ] )

Idéntico a SplFileObject::fgets(), excepto que SplFileObject::fgetss() intenta eliminar las etiquetas HTML y PHP de el texto que se lee.

Parámetros

allowable_tags

Parámetro opcional para especificar etiquetas que no deben ser eliminados.

Valores devueltos

Devuelve un string conteniendo la siguiente línea de el fichero con el código HTML y PHP eliminado, o FALSE en caso de error.

Ejemplos

Ejemplo #1 Ejemplo de SplFileObject::fgetss()

<?php
$str 
= <<<EOD
<html><body>
 <p>Bienvenid@! Hoy es el <?php echo(date('jS')); ?> de <?= date('F'); ?>.</p>
</body></html>
Texto fuera del bloque HTML.
EOD;
file_put_contents("ejemplo.php"$str);

$fichero = new SplFileObject("ejemplo.php");
while (!
$fichero->eof()) {
    echo 
$fichero->fgetss();
}
?>

El resultado del ejemplo sería algo similar a:


Bienvenid@! Hoy es el  de .

Texto fuera del bloque HTML.

Ver también



add a note add a note User Contributed Notes SplFileObject::fgetss - [0 notes]
There are no user contributed notes for this page.

 
show source | credits | stats | sitemap | contact | advertising | mirror sites